Abstract
A novel micromachined coupled-resonator waveguide diplexer operating in frequency range 220-325 GHz is presented. The diplexer has been synthesised using coupling matrix optimization of multiple coupled resonators, and constructed with innovative structure using micromachining technology. The diplexer structure consists of waveguide cavity resonators, waveguide extensions, and embedded bends, and it has been made of four layers of metal coated SU-8. The diplexer structure allows accurate alignment and secure connection with the flanges of waveguide test ports and matched loads.
